Interestingly, this was one of the few Australian books that mentions Oca or New Zealand yams, which I'm growing for the 2nd year. This made this book the winner over another choice.
There's some good advice on what and what to use for fertilizer that I've already followed. (Complete for the yams and one that's slightly higher in nitrogen and potassium for the potatoes and tomatoes in my fairly horrible soil).
So far it's given them all a boost this summer, without causing less flavour in the tomatoes.
There wasn't as much useful advice on how to grow chillies from seed, but I'll work with what I have. I would have welcomed more advice on the tomato pruning, but my neighbour the tomato genius seems to know more than any book anyway so I'm still ahead.
The A-Z of plant problems at the back looks like a useful reference, as does the yield tables.
Overall, a useful book for all parts of the gardening cycle, for this part of Australia.
